Silk is the strongest natural textile in the world. This textile was just recently surpassed in strength by a lab-engineered biomaterial, but it remains the strongest fabric made through natural processes. Despite its immense tensile strength, silk is generally prized for other reasons. Silk’s softness has made it a hotly desired commodity throughout history, and this simple fiber has built legendary trade routes and transformed cultures throughout the Old World.

Another great feature of silk is that it’s naturally temperature regulating, meaning it’s perfect for keeping you both cool in the summer and comfortable during winter. Because it’s made from thin, lightweight natural fibers, silk allows for better air circulation than synthetic material, and is ideal for tempering body heat. This quality makes silk exceptionally breathable (even superior to cotton!) with good moisture-wicking capabilities.
Silk is a fabric with a multitude of uses. It is a popular choice for clothing and comforters because of its softness and breathability. Moreover, its smooth texture and skin-friendly nature make it a comfortable option for bed sheets. Additionally, silk’s high ignition point makes it a great material for interior decoration. And the story of the ultimate fiber started with tea in ancient China. Legend has it that Empress Leizu stumbled upon silk’s enchanting secret when a cocoon fell into her tea, unraveling a long thread before her eyes. Captivated by its luminous beauty, she embarked on a quest to cultivate silkworms and unlock the magic of this extraordinary fiber. It is believed that Empress Leizu made this discovery around 2700 BC, bringing silk to life and forever changing the course of history.
